Visualising an ideal day

  • Set the scene by finding a quiet place. Minimise distractions. Now close your eyes and imagine your perfect day, beginning to end.
  • Try to think specifically about your actions, company, activities, and feelings throughout the day.
  • Identify the key elements and note down the most outstanding moment - activities, interactions, or feelings.
  • Start small by picking just one element you can introduce in reality.
  • Make the change and observe how it impacts your sense of balance and fulfilment by noticing what shifts.
